You do realize that the frame doesn't touch your back right? It only does if you're bending over really far like your picking something up, even then it is not a problem. If it's touching your back them you have it adjusted wrong. This brings up another plus of the Alice pack, it allows a ton of airflow between your back and the pack, it is amazing in the summer.

The Pack in the picture is a USGI Medium ALICE pack. Don't get the Rothco one, that brand is notorious for low-quality goods. You can get genuine ALICE packs off ebay for cheap, though as has already been said, commercial packs are better if you're willing to pay more.

8 year military fag here.
Go to a military surplus, buy an alice frame. They shouldn't cost you more than $15. Buy an alice pack in decent condition (again should be cheap). There's variable sizes.

Get an iso mat and cut it up and shove in gap of the frame. Buy water proofing bags or just use trash bags. Shove all your shit in that you want to carry.

I'll give you a tip,
if you get a frame, try to go for one without bars crossing over your spine and upper back,
if it crosses your lumbar region, thats fine, after you get the ideal frame (try and find a lightweight option),
Fishing Net, fucking fishing net mate, that shit is heaven. Weave it over your frame tight, it provides support and breathability depending on what you wear, but I've been doing it for awhile now and it is incredible, might not be for you but thought you might appreciate it.
Also take into consideration your stature, if your a big guy the outer frame may rub against your shoulder blades.
